Unhappy Oil problem need help

Not sure whats is wrong. I changed the oil and after 200 miles the oil light comes on and I hear valves clicking. I check the oil level and it is ok. I put in another quart of oil and the clicking stopped. I drive for anotehr 50 miles and the same thing happens. When i look in the crankcase it looks dry. Could this be signs of a bad oil pump not pumping oil to the top. I cannot find any oil leaks. Is this expensive to replace?

I know this is an old post, but I'll answer anyway.

When you said the oil level was "OK", does that mean it was within it's low and high level marks on the dipstick? You then added another quart to an already "OK" level of oil. I'm thinking you have too much oil in your van and it's frothing the oil which will give you a lot of problems.
